Running Brook Road
About this track
Running Brook Road is an 8.7 km challenging track near Armadale, suited to experienced walkers and trail runners. The unpaved surface demands good fitness and solid footwear. This is a solid half-day outing through bush terrain with some elevation changes that keep the pace demanding throughout.

What to expect
Uneven unpaved track with sections of rock, root and loose earth. Sustained climbs and descents mean it's not a flat stroll—expect genuine bush hiking rather than a groomed path. Shade varies with forest density. Signposting on rough tracks is often minimal, so navigation skills and attention to the trail are essential. Muddy patches are likely after rain.
Good to know
Carry at least 1.5 litres of water; bush tracks offer no facilities. Wear sturdy hiking boots for ankle support on uneven ground. Start early to finish in daylight. Summer heat and bushfire risk make this a spring, autumn or winter choice. Mobile reception may be patchy. Tell someone your route.
